Mautic's API enables you to build custom integrations and applications on top
of Mautic. This means you can connect Mautic to other tools in your tech stack,
automate processes, or even build your own Mautic-powered app.

import { axios } from "@pipedream/platform"
export default defineComponent({
props: {
mautic: {
type: "app",
app: "mautic",
}
},
async run({steps, $}) {
return await axios($, {
url: `${this.mautic.$auth.mautic_url}/api/users/self`,
headers: {
Authorization: `Bearer ${this.mautic.$auth.oauth_access_token}`,
},
})
},
})

import { axios } from "@pipedream/platform"
export default defineComponent({
props: {
twilio: {
type: "app",
app: "twilio",
}
},
async run({steps, $}) {
return await axios($, {
url: `https://api.twilio.com/2010-04-01/Accounts.json`,
auth: {
username: `${this.twilio.$auth.AccountSid}`,
password: `${this.twilio.$auth.AuthToken}`,
},
})
},
})
